                        INTRODUCTION With the Cordless DUALphone you can make ordinary telephone calls and Internet calls using Skype™ and  SkypeOut. ■  An ordinary telephone call is a call between two telephone line subscribers.  ■  A Skype™ call is between two registered Skype™ users. These calls are free of charge. ■ A SkypeOut call is made via the Internet to an ordinary telephone number anywhere in the world   TM  using the Skype software.                         HOW TO CONNECT A HEADSET   The Cordless DUALphone supports the use of headsets. Using a headset allows you to talk through a  microphone and saves you from having to hold the handset during a conversation. Answering calls is  the same procedure as normal.   Plug the headset into the jack located on the left side of the handset (under the rubber flap).                         MAKING CALLS HOW TO MAKE AN ORDINARY TELEPHONE CALL   Enter the telephone number and press to place call.     DEL If you make a mistake, press the key to delete incorrect digits, before you press .       NOTE: If you need to insert a pause in the dialling string press and hold . This will insert a three- second pause. Each press and hold of the button adds three additional seconds to the pause.                         HOW TO MAKE A SKYPEOUT CALL SkypeOut allows you to use your Internet connection to call ordinary telephones and mobile telephones  worldwide. To make a SkypeOut call enter the telephone number you wish to call and press .     NOTE: The Skype software must be activated on your PC in order to perform SkypeOut and Skype™  calls.                         REDIAL OUTGOING CALLS With the Cordless DUALphone you can redial any number from the redial list. HOW TO REDIAL A TELEPHONE NUMBER FROM THE REDIAL LIST   You can view a list of the last 30 calls you made. To redial a telephone number that you have previously called press ▲  or ▼ with the handset in idle  state. You will now see the call list.                         HOW TO CHANGE COUNTRY SETTING IMPORTANT NOTE: You should only change the country setting if you take your telephone to another  country and connect the telephone to an ordinary telephone line. Press OK to enter the menu and scroll to find 8 > Country. Press OK to enter and scroll the list of        countries. Press OK to set your country preference.                         TELEPHONE BOOK The Cordless DUALphone can store up to 160 contacts in the telephone book. As well as entering  numbers and storing them in the telephone book you can also store the numbers from the call log and  from the redial list. The handset display holds up to 16 characters for a name and up to 22 digits for  telephone numbers. The redial list holds the last 30 calls you make from the handsets.                         HOW TO EDIT OR DELETE A TELEPHONE BOOK ENTRY Press . Use ▼ to find the entry you wish to edit. Press OK and select 1 > Edit from the menu.         The number is now ready to be edited. To delete a digit, press the DEL key.      To delete, select 2 > Delete entry instead and press OK to confirm.     To delete all entries in the telephone book select 3 > Delete all and press OK to confirm.
